Creation of Sankey Charts

Creating effective Sankey charts requires careful calculation and attention to detail. Here’s a rundown of the process:

Data Gathering and Preparation

Begin with collecting relevant data about the process you wish to visualize. Sankey charts depict mass flow systems, so the data will represent quantities, often measured in units such as kilograms, liters, or cubic meters.

Calculation of Ratios

To create a Sankey chart, you don’t need to show volume or mass directly on the chart. Instead, you calculate the ratio of the flow in a branch to the flow in the overall system. Ratios are then applied to the width of each Sankey stream.

Determining Branch Widths

The width of each Sankey stream is proportional to the quantity of material, energy, or other entities moving through it. The width is typically scaled down by a constant factor for legibility. Thus, if you want to visualize energy loss in an industrial process, for example, you would calculate the energy ratio for each branch and scale the width accordingly.

Placement of Branches

The placement of branches represents the flow through a process. It’s essential to have a clear understanding of the system to place the branches correctly. Sankey charts are typically organized so that larger quantities move through wider branches and smaller ones through narrower ones.

Applications of Sankey Charts

Sankey diagrams find applications in a wide range of fields, from environmental studies to business analysis:

Environmental and Energy Studies

Sankey charts are often used in energy flow diagrams to illustrate the direction and scale of energy transfer. They are also an excellent tool for waste analysis, highlighting areas where materials or energy might be lost in a process.

Systems Analysis and Process Optimization

Sankey diagrams are valuable in breaking down complex processes and revealing inefficiencies. Companies use them to optimize manufacturing processes, identify areas for cost reduction, and improve energy efficiency.

Finance and Business Models

In financial analysis, Sankey diagrams can illustrate the flow of capital, showing where investments are allocated and where losses are incurred. This enables businesses to make more informed investment decisions.

Infrastructure Planning

They are also used in infrastructure planning and project management, helping urban planners understand the flow of resources in their projects and to identify bottlenecks.

Health and Nutrition

Sankey diagrams can be used to show the flow of nutrients in the body (e.g., macronutrients, trace minerals), or the financial flow within healthcare systems.
